What you should know about Vaginal Candidiasis

Candidiasis is a fungus infection caused by candida or yeast (a type of fungus) called candida albicans.
Candida lives in the body or on the skin without any problem, but becomes an infection when it grows out of normal. Vaginal candidiasis occurs when candida multiply and causes an infection in the vagina, when the environment inside the vaginal changes in a way that encourage its growth. It is also called vulvovaginal CANDIDIASIS, or vaginal yeast infection.

SYMPTOMS
– Vaginal itching or sores
– Pain during sexual intercourse
– Pain or discomfort during urinating
– Abnormal vaginal discharge
– Redness, swelling and cracks in the wall of the vagina.

RISK AT GETTING VAGINAL CANDIDIASIS
– When pregnant
– Use of hormonal contraceptives
– Having a weakened immune system (having HIV infection or taking medication that weakens the Immune system such as steroid and chemotherapy

HOW TO PREVENT VAGINAL CANDIDIASIS
– Wearing of cotton underwear might help reduce the chances of getting the yeast infection
– Reduce the intake of drugs that reduce the immune system
– Taken antibiotics can lead to vaginal candidiasis so take the antibiotics only when prescribed

DIAGNOSIS AND TESTING
Healthcare providers usually diagnose the vaginal CANDIDIASIS by taken a small sample of vaginal discharge to be examined under a microscope or it is send to laboratory for a fungal culture. However, a positive fungal culture doesn’t always mean that cadida is causing the symptoms because woman have candida without having any symptoms

TREATMENT
Treatment of vaginal CANDIDIASIS is by taken antifungal Medicine
– Apply antifungal passery inside the vaginal for 3 – 6 days depending on the strength and type of the drugs
– Use of oral antifungal drug of fluconazole 150mg as a single dose
– Use of clotrimazole cream to be applied on the valva to stop itching and burning sensation
– For reoccurrence – use of 150mg of fluconazole every 72 hours for first 3 dose and take 150mg every week for 6 month
